Female on the Run: A Look into the Lives of Notorious Fugitives
In recent years, the rise of true crime documentaries and podcasts has led to a growing fascination with the lives of notorious fugitives. The public's interest in these stories is often fueled by the intrigue surrounding their escape tactics and the lengths they go to evade capture. But what drives women to flee the law, and what are the common characteristics that set them apart from their male counterparts?

How it Works
For most women, the decision to become a fugitive is often a last resort, stemming from circumstances such as domestic violence, financial desperation, or a desire to escape an unbearable situation. Once on the run, women employ various tactics to evade capture, including using fake identities, traveling to remote areas, and leveraging social networks to gather resources. While some women may have partners or accomplices who assist them, others go it alone.

Opportunities and Realistic Risks
While becoming a fugitive may seem like a bold move, it's essential to consider the risks involved. These can include extreme personal danger, destruction of existing relationships, and potential harm to innocent parties. Moreover, the legal consequences of being caught can be severe, often involving extended prison sentences.
